Performance Analysis of Abradable Coating Systems for Aircraft Gas Turbines

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Three CoNiCrAlY/YSZ/MgAl2O4 abradable liner configurations on a nickel‐superalloy are evaluated by thermal‐gradient cycling and incursion tests. Laser ablation of the bondcoat and/or Y2O3‐stabilized ZrO2 (YSZ) intermediate layer increases mechanical interlocking and bonding for thick topcoats.

Automatic Control of the Temperature in Phase Change Problems with Memory

open access: yesZeitschrift für Analysis und ihre Anwendungen, 2001
We study a parabolic two-phase system with memory occupying a bounded and smooth domain. The heat exchange at part of the boundary is controlled by a thermostat. Assuming on the phase variable either a relaxation dynamics or a Stefan condition, we prove existence and uniqueness results for feedback control problems corresponding to two different types ...
